Job description

Medical Assistant -Pediatrics

GI Alliance is seeking an experienced Medical Assistant for a Pediatrics clinic.

Duties of this position include, but are not limited to, the following:

Position purpose

This position may be involved in both the clinical and administrative areas including assisting physicians with patient care and handling clerical, environmental, and organizational tasks. Provides information to patients so they may fully utilize and benefit from the clinical services.

Responsibilities/Duties/Functions/Tasks

• Fulfills patient care responsibilities as assigned that may include checking schedules and organizing patient flow; accompanying patients to exam/procedure room; assisting patients as needed with walking transfers, dressing, collecting specimens, preparing for exam, etc.; collecting patient history; checking vital signs; performing screenings per provider guidelines; assisting providers as needed; charting; phone triage; medication administration; vaccines administration; relaying instructions to patients/families; answering calls, and providing pertinent information; prescription verifications with physicians orders.

• Fulfills clerical responsibilities as assigned that may include sending/receiving patient medical records; obtaining lab/X-ray reports, hospital notes, referral information, etc.; completing forms/requisitions as needed; scheduling appointments; patient check-in and check-out; verifying insurance coverage and patient demographics; managing and updating charts to ensure that information is complete and filed appropriately.

• Fulfills organizational responsibilities as assigned including respecting/promoting patient rights; responding appropriately to emergency codes; sharing problems relating to patients and/or staff with immediate supervisor.

• Other duties as assigned.

Qualifications

Qualifications

Education: High school diploma or general equivalency diploma (GED), medical assistant diploma from an accredited vocational institution, or a college course in medical assisting.

Experience: Minimum one year of recent experience working in a medical facility as a medical assistant and/or documented evidence of externship completed in a medical office. Experience working in a Gastroenterology practice is preferred.
